Exploring the Concept of Agency in Biology

This chapter delves into the ongoing debate and confusion surrounding the concept of agency in evolutionary biology, as well as its relationship to fitness, selection, and adaptation. The speakers discuss different definitions of agency, explore the idea of agency below the level of organisms, and question the role of agency in understanding adaptive evolution.
